A marketplace platform serves as a virtual marketplace where multiple vendors can list and sell their products or services, providing a centralized hub for customers to browse and make purchases.

One of the key benefits of using a marketplace platform is the access to a larger customer base. By listing their products on a popular marketplace, businesses can tap into millions of potential customers who visit the platform daily in search of products and services. This level of exposure would be difficult and costly to achieve on their own, making marketplace platforms an attractive option for businesses looking to expand their reach.
Another advantage of using a marketplace platform is the built-in trust and credibility that comes with it. Most customers are familiar with popular marketplaces and feel comfortable making purchases through them, knowing that their transactions are secure and their personal information is protected. This level of trust can help businesses attract new customers who may be hesitant to buy from lesser-known websites.
marketplace platforms also offer a range of tools and features that can help businesses manage their operations more efficiently. From inventory management to customer support, these platforms provide businesses with the resources they need to streamline their processes and focus on growing their business. Many marketplace platforms also offer data analytics and reporting tools that can help businesses track their performance and make informed decisions to optimize their sales.

However, while the benefits of using a marketplace platform are clear, businesses should also be aware of the challenges that come with it. Competition on these platforms can be fierce, with thousands of vendors vying for the attention of customers. Standing out in a crowded marketplace requires businesses to have a strong brand identity, high-quality products, and a solid marketing strategy.
Businesses also need to be mindful of the fees and commissions charged by marketplace platforms. While the cost of using these platforms can vary, businesses should factor in these expenses when determining their pricing strategy and profit margins. It’s important to weigh the costs against the benefits and assess whether using a marketplace platform is the right choice for your business.
